Rubber Feet for Patio Furniture

Rubber feet are an essential component of patio furniture for several reasons. First, they protect the furniture from the elements. Rain, snow, and sun can all damage patio furniture if it is not properly protected. Rubber feet create a barrier between the furniture and the ground, which helps to keep the furniture dry and free from damage. Second, rubber feet provide stability. They help to keep the furniture from sliding around on the patio, which can be dangerous for people walking or playing nearby.

When choosing rubber feet for your patio furniture, there are a few things to keep in mind. First, consider the size and weight of the furniture. The feet should be large enough to support the weight of the furniture, and they should be wide enough to provide stability. Second, consider the material of the feet. Rubber feet can be made from a variety of materials, including natural rubber, synthetic rubber, and plastic. The best material for the feet will depend on the climate and conditions in which the furniture will be used.

If you live in a climate with extreme weather conditions, such as high heat or cold, you should choose rubber feet that are made from a durable material, such as synthetic rubber or plastic. These materials can withstand the elements and will not break down or deteriorate over time. If you live in a climate with mild weather conditions, you may be able to use rubber feet that are made from natural rubber. Natural rubber is softer than synthetic rubber or plastic, so it will provide more comfort underfoot. However, natural rubber is not as durable as synthetic rubber or plastic, so it may not last as long.

Once you have chosen the right rubber feet for your patio furniture, you need to install them properly. The feet should be attached to the bottom of the furniture legs using screws or bolts. Make sure that the feet are attached securely, so that they will not come off when the furniture is moved.

Rubber feet are an essential component of patio furniture. They protect the furniture from the elements, provide stability, and can make the furniture more comfortable to use. By choosing the right rubber feet for your furniture and installing them properly, you can help to extend the life of your patio furniture and enjoy it for years to come.
